Corcel Plc is listed in the Misc Nonmtl Minrls, Ex Fuels sector of the London Stock Exchange with ticker CRCL. The last closing price for Corcel was 0.13p. Over the last year, Corcel shares have traded in a share price range of 0.105p to 1.375p.

Corcel currently has 1,874,794,153 shares in issue. The market capitalisation of Corcel is £2.44 million. Corcel has a price to earnings ratio (PE ratio) of -1.86.
